Detailed explanation-1: -A strait is a narrow body of water that connects two larger bodies of water. It may be formed by a fracture in an isthmus, a narrow body of land that connects two bodies of water.

Detailed explanation-3: -The correct answer is option 4 i.e., Strait. A narrow passage of water connecting two large water bodies like seas and oceans is called strait. Example-Strait of Malacca. A lagoon is a water body separated from larger water bodies by a natural barrier.
